Transaction 45ba496d37bebf5b85bd57936d7cef41660f3aa24cd74f273caaf9f35a802253

1 Input
2 Outputs
  • 45ba496d37bebf5b85bd57936d7cef41660f3aa24cd74f273caaf9f35a802253:0
  • value  39900
    address  12odEZ6GhNSxaBDjAvoiBHcyEnWzgaSiYo
  • 45ba496d37bebf5b85bd57936d7cef41660f3aa24cd74f273caaf9f35a802253:1
  • value  836000
    address  34f58qPGToLvE5EJxcH11X6JDkfPPo2QCh